Simplified Installation: Pre-assembled conductors eliminate on-site bundling, reducing labor time by 40% compared to traditional single conductors.
Space Efficiency: The compact bundle minimizes pole clutter, ideal for urban areas with aesthetic constraints.
Enhanced Safety: Insulated Conductors prevent accidental contact, reducing short-circuit risks—vital in populated zones.
Conductivity: High-purity aluminum (99.5%+) ensures low resistance, with power loss below 3% over 1km spans.
Lightweight: 30% lighter than copper, reducing pole load and enabling longer spans (up to 60m), lowering infrastructure costs.
Corrosion Resistance: A natural oxide layer, combined with insulation, protects against moisture and pollutants, extending service life to 25+ years.
UV Protection: Formulated to withstand prolonged sunlight, preventing brittleness in tropical or desert climates.
Moisture Barrier: Impermeable to rain, snow, and humidity, critical for outdoor overhead installations.
Temperature Tolerance: Operates in -40°C to 90°C, ensuring reliability in extreme weather—from cold winters to scorching summers.
Abrasion Resistance: Withstands contact with tree branches, debris, and installation tools, reducing maintenance needs.
Tensioning: Use calibrated tools to apply 10-15% of the cable’s ultimate tensile strength, preventing sag or overstretching.
Support Spacing: For 3*70+54.6+25, space supports every 40-50m; for smaller variants, up to 60m.
Termination: Use insulated connectors compatible with aluminum to ensure watertight, low-resistance joints.
Visual Inspections: Quarterly checks for insulation damage, loose supports, or vegetation contact.
Electrical Testing: Annual insulation resistance tests (target: >100MΩ) to detect moisture ingress.
Weather Adaptation: Post-storm checks for ice/snow accumulation, especially in high-load areas.
